My take: you will rarely get a straight lock like you are expecting with one of these birds. You may have at first, just by luck; but after experiencing flight with these things for quite a while now, I don't consider them to have that kind of accuracy.
Someone mentioned trying other props, which is a good suggestion, but I didn't see any replies.
Remember too that the shape of your craft, including any decals with furled ends / corners, are going to add slight fluctuations to the flight conditions.
Have you ever had a rough landing (not a crash, but just a hard hit)? Those landing legs can change their shape after awhile due to handling, landing, packing, and just age. Also, your props could be unbalanced, or if you've plowed your way through some branches or even soft leaves, the edges of the blades may no longer be as smooth as they were.
Have you ever done an RTH all the way to landing? Have you noticed that it never quite lands exactly where it took off from? I think you're expecting more precision than the craft has.
